17-4 PH: The properties of chromium-nickel steel at a glance
The high-quality, martensitic hardenable stainless steel WL 1.4548 is especially often used in aerospace and aviation but also in plant and mechanical engineering as well as in measurement and control technology. When it comes to these specific applications, 17-4 PH impresses with its properties:
- Good corrosion resistance
- High strength and viscosity up to 310°C
- Strength can be increased by cold forming and subsequent aging
- High yield limit and wear resistance
- Suitable for use in marine environments (exception: susceptibility to crevice corrosion in stagnant seawater)
- Good forgeability and weldability
Depending on the heat treatment, various properties can be generated. A distinction is made between different gradations:
- WL 1.4548.9 (17-4 PH Cond. A)
- WL 1.4548.3 (17-4 PH Cond. H1100)
- WL 1.4548.4 (17-4 PH Cond. H1025)
- WL 1.4548.5 (17-4 PH Cond. H925)
- WL 1.4548.6 (17-4 PH Cond. H900)

CHEMICAL COMPOSITION IN %
| C[%] | Si[%] | Mn[%] | P[%] | S[%] | Cr[%] | Ni[%] | Cu[%] | Nb[%] |
| 0,07 | ≤1 | ≤1 | ≤0,025 | ≤0,025 | 15,0-17,5 | 3,0-5,0 | 3,0-5,0 | 0,15-0,45 |
MECHANICAL PROPERTIES 1.4548 (RODS)
| .9 | .3 | .4 | .5 | .6 | |
| heat treatment | solution annealed | hardened | hardened | hardened | hardened |
| 0,2% Yield point [N/mm2] | - | 790 | 1000 | 1070 | 1170 |
| Tensile strength [N/mm2] | - | 960 | 1070 | 1170 | 1310 |
| Elongation at break A5 [%] | - | 12 | 11 | 10 | 10 |
| Hardness [HB] | ≤363 | 30≤HRC≤38 | 35≤HRC≤42 | 38≤HRC≤45 | 40≤HRC≤47 |
MECHANICAL PROPERTIES 1.4548 (SHEET AND PLATES)
EXEMPLARY FOR MATERIAL THICKNESS 0.4 - 6 MM
| .9 | .4 | .6 | |
| Heat treatment | solution annealed | hardend | hardend |
| 0,2% Yield point [N/mm2] | ≤1100 | 1000 | 1070 |
| Tensile strength [N/mm2] | ≤1270 | 1070 | 1310 |
| Elongation at break A5 [%] | 3 | 6 | 5 |
| Hardness [HB] | ≤370 | 341≤HRC≤416 | 392≤HRC≤480 |
